Frequently Asked Questions about Little Italy

How much are Studio apartments in Little Italy?

There are currently 78 Studio Apartments in Little Italy with rent ranges from $1,100 to $7,668 with an average price of $2,929.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Little Italy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Little Italy ranges from $700 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,545.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Little Italy c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Little Italy range from $1,470 to $14,437.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,401.

How expensive are Little Italy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 139 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Little Italy on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,075 to $16,890 - averaging $4,731 for the location.
